Home Exercise Bikes: A Comprehensive Guide to Staying Fit at Home
In the hectic world these days, discovering the time and motivation to hit the health club can be an overwhelming task. Nevertheless, the increase of home fitness equipment has made it simpler than ever to preserve a healthy lifestyle without leaving the comfort of your home. Amongst the most popular devices in this category are home exercise bikes. Whether you are a seasoned professional athlete or a fitness newbie, a home stationary bicycle can be an exceptional addition to your workout regimen. Low Impact Exercise
Exercise bikes provide a low-impact kind of cardio, making them perfect for individuals with joint discomfort, injuries, or other physical limitations. The smooth pedaling motion assists to reduce the strain on your knees, hips, and back, allowing you to get a good exercise without the danger of injury.
Cardiovascular Fitness
Routine use of an exercise bike can considerably enhance your cardiovascular health. It helps to enhance your heart and lungs, increase your endurance, and decrease the threat of cardiovascular disease and other chronic conditions.
Weight Management
Stationary bicycle are outstanding for burning calories and assisting in weight loss. Depending upon the strength and duration of your exercise, you can burn anywhere from 400 to 1000 calories per hour. This makes them a valuable tool for anyone wanting to handle their weight.
Stress Relief
exercise cycle for sale is a well-known tension reducer, and utilizing a stationary bicycle is no exception. The rhythmic pedaling and the release of endorphins can help to reduce tension and enhance your mental wellness.
Variety of Workouts
Many home stationary bicycle feature pre-programmed exercises and adjustable resistance levels, allowing you to differ your regular and keep your exercises interesting. You can select from interval training, hill climbs, and endurance trips, amongst others.
Types of Home Exercise Bikes
Upright Bikes
Upright bikes are the most traditional type of stationary bicycle. They carefully resemble a roadway bicycle and are excellent for those who choose a more natural riding position. Upright bikes are perfect for targeting the quadriceps, hamstrings, and glutes, and they can be used for a vast array of exercises, consisting of high-intensity period training (HIIT).
Recumbent Bikes
Recumbent bikes have a more reclined seating position and a back-rest, making them more comfortable for long workouts. They are especially ideal for people with back or knee issues. Recumbent bikes engage the lower body while likewise providing support for the back and core, making them an outstanding choice for those wanting to improve their total fitness.
Indoor Cycling Bikes
Indoor biking bikes, likewise known as spin bikes, are designed to imitate the experience of outdoor cycling. They are frequently used in group cycling classes and can be highly inspiring. Spin bikes are more robust and provide a more extreme workout, making them perfect for severe cyclists and those seeking to develop leg strength and endurance.
Interactive Bikes
Interactive bikes, such as those from companies like Peloton and NordicTrack, featured integrated screens and internet connection. They allow users to take part in live or on-demand classes, follow individualized exercise strategies, and track their progress. These bikes use a more engaging and social workout experience, which can be specifically beneficial for those who discover it challenging to remain inspired by themselves.
How to Choose the Right Home Exercise Bike
Consider Your Fitness Goals
What do you wish to attain with your stationary bicycle? If you are aiming to enhance your cardiovascular health, any kind of bike will work. However, if you are training for a particular event or sport, an indoor cycling bike might be preferable. For basic physical fitness and comfort, a recumbent bike could be the best choice.
Examine Your Space
Home stationary bicycle can differ considerably in size. Upright bikes are normally more compact, while recumbent bikes need more area due to their reclined style. Interactive bikes often have larger screens and might need additional room for the screen and the bike itself.
Spending plan
Home exercise bikes range from budget-friendly options to high-end designs with advanced features. Determine just how much you want to spend and search for a bike that provides the very best worth for your spending plan. Interactive bikes tend to be more expensive however provide a more detailed exercise experience.
Features and Functions
Consider what features are very important to you. Some bikes include integrated resistance levels, heart rate screens, and tracking apps. Others may have compatibility with fitness platforms like Zwift or Peloton. If you delight in using innovation to improve your workouts, a bike with these functions may be worth the investment.
Convenience and Stability
Evaluate the bike before you purchase, if possible. Make certain the seat is comfortable and adjustable to your height. Examine the stability of the bike to ensure it does not wobble or feel unsteady throughout extreme exercises.
Customer Reviews and Support
Read consumer examines to get an idea of the bike's performance and durability. Search for bikes from respectable manufacturers that offer good customer support and service warranty alternatives.
Upkeep and Care
Regular Cleaning
Wipe down the bike after each use with a damp fabric to remove sweat and dirt. This will help to keep the bike in good condition and prevent the buildup of germs.
Lubrication
Inspect the producer's recommendations for lubrication. Some bikes require regular chain or belt lubrication to ensure smooth and quiet operation.
Tightening up and Adjustment
Regularly check and tighten any loose bolts or screws. Change the seat and handlebars as needed to preserve a comfortable and ergonomic riding position.
Inspect for Wear and Tear
Examine the bike regularly for signs of wear and tear, such as frayed cables or damaged parts. Change any damaged components to ensure the bike remains safe and practical.
Shop in a Dry Place
Keep your exercise bike for sale bike in a dry, well-ventilated location to prevent rust and rust. Prevent storing it in wet basements or garages.
Often Asked Questions (FAQs).
Q: Are home stationary bicycle as effective as health club bikes?
A: Yes, home stationary bicycle can be simply as reliable as fitness center bikes. The key is to choose a bike that suits your fitness goals and to preserve a consistent exercise cycle for sale regimen. Lots of home bikes feature innovative features that can imitate the experience of a fitness center bike, consisting of adjustable resistance levels and pre-programmed exercises.
Q: How often should I utilize a stationary bicycle?
A: For optimum outcomes, goal to utilize your stationary bicycle a minimum of 3-4 times a week. Each session needs to last between 20-60 minutes, depending on your fitness level and goals. Consistency is key to attaining and maintaining your preferred fitness outcomes.
Q: Can I drop weight with a stationary bicycle?
A: Absolutely! Commercial Exercise Bike bikes are a fantastic tool for weight-loss. They can assist you burn a significant variety of calories, specifically when combined with a well balanced diet plan and other kinds of exercise. HIIT workouts on an exercise bike can be particularly effective for weight loss.
Q: Are recumbent bikes much better for elders?
A: Yes, recumbent bikes are often recommended for senior citizens due to their comfortable and helpful design. The reclined position reduces pressure on the back and joints, making them a much safer and more comfortable alternative for older grownups.
Q: Can I use an exercise bike while pregnant?
A: Yes, but it's essential to seek advice from your doctor first. Low-impact workouts like biking on a stationary bike can be advantageous throughout pregnancy, as they assist to preserve cardiovascular fitness and minimize pregnancy-related discomfort. Make sure the bike is gotten used to a comfy height and that the intensity of your exercises is proper for your stage of pregnancy.
Q: Do I need special shoes for an exercise bike?
A: While you do not necessarily need special shoes, it's recommended to use shoes with a good grip and support. If you are using an indoor cycling bike with clip-in pedals, you will need cycling shoes for the best performance and safety.

Tips for Getting one of the most Out of Your Home Exercise Bike.
Set Realistic Goals: Start with achievable goals and gradually increase the strength and period of your workouts.
Mix It Up: Vary your workouts to avoid dullness and difficulty different muscle groups. Try various kinds of rides, such as interval training or hill climbs.
Stay Hydrated: Keep a water bottle nearby to stay hydrated during your exercises.
Usage Proper Form: Maintain correct type to maximize the efficiency of your workouts and reduce the danger of injury. Keep your back straight, shoulders unwinded, and core engaged.
Track Your Progress: Use the bike's built-in tracking features or a fitness app to monitor your development and stay motivated.
Make It Fun: Consider using a bike with interactive features or streaming exercise classes to keep your workouts engaging and satisfying.
